免费注册
langchain大模型开发:解决常见问题的实用技巧

langchain大模型开发:解决常见问题的实用技巧

作者: 网友投稿
阅读数:10
更新时间:2024-04-09 21:10:54
浏览次数:2746次
langchain大模型开发:解决常见问题的实用技巧

一、langchain大模型开发概述

1.1 langchain大模型的定义与特点

Langchain大模型是一种基于深度学习的自然语言处理模型,其特点在于其庞大的参数规模和强大的文本处理能力。这种模型通过训练大量的文本数据,能够理解和生成复杂的自然语言文本,实现自然语言生成、文本分类、问答等多种任务。Langchain大模型的出现,极大地推动了自然语言处理领域的发展。

Langchain大模型的核心在于其深度神经网络结构,通过多层的非线性变换,实现对输入文本的深度理解和高效生成。同时,这种模型还采用了大量的训练数据和技术手段,如预训练、迁移学习等,以提高模型的性能和泛化能力。

1.2 langchain大模型开发的重要性与应用场景

Langchain大模型的开发对于自然语言处理领域的发展具有重要意义。首先,它推动了自然语言处理技术的不断创新和突破,使得机器能够更好地理解和处理人类语言。其次,Langchain大模型的应用场景非常广泛,如智能客服、智能问答、机器翻译、文本生成等,为人们的生活和工作带来了极大的便利。

例如,在智能客服领域,Langchain大模型可以实现自动化的问答和咨询服务,提高客户满意度和服务效率。在机器翻译领域,Langchain大模型可以实现高质量的文本翻译,帮助人们跨越语言障碍进行交流。此外,Langchain大模型还可以应用于文本生成、情感分析、文本分类等多种任务,为自然语言处理领域的发展注入了新的活力。

二、langchain大模型开发常见问题及解决技巧

2.1 数据处理问题

2.1.1 数据清洗与预处理技巧

在Langchain大模型的开发过程中,数据清洗和预处理是非常关键的一步。由于训练数据通常规模庞大且来源复杂,因此可能存在大量的噪声数据和无效数据。为了保证模型的训练效果,需要对数据进行清洗和预处理,包括去除重复数据、填充缺失值、处理异常值、文本分词等。

一种有效的数据清洗方法是使用正则表达式或自然语言处理工具对数据进行过滤和清洗。同时,还可以采用数据增强的方法,如同义词替换、随机插入、随机删除等,以增加数据的多样性和泛化能力。

2.1.2 数据集选择与扩充方法

选择合适的数据集对于Langchain大模型的训练至关重要。一般来说,数据集应该与任务相关且规模足够大,以保证模型的训练效果和泛化能力。同时,还可以采用数据扩充的方法,如旋转图像、翻转文本等,以增加数据的多样性和数量。

在文本处理领域,一种常用的数据扩充方法是使用同义词替换和随机插入等方法,以增加文本的多样性和丰富性。此外,还可以采用预训练模型进行特征提取和数据增强,以提高模型的训练效果和泛化能力。

2.2 模型训练与优化

2.2.1 模型超参数调整与优化策略

在Langchain大模型的训练过程中,超参数的调整对于模型的性能具有重要影响。常见的超参数包括学习率、批量大小、迭代次数等。为了找到最优的超参数组合,可以采用网格搜索、随机搜索等方法进行超参数优化。

此外,还可以采用自适应学习率算法、梯度下降优化算法等技术手段来优化模型的训练过程。这些算法可以根据模型的训练情况动态调整学习率和梯度下降方向,从而提高模型的训练速度和收敛效果。

2.2.2 模型训练过程中的常见问题及解决方法

在Langchain大模型的训练过程中,可能会出现过拟合、欠拟合等常见问题。过拟合是指模型在训练数据上表现良好,但在测试数据上表现较差;欠拟合则是指模型在训练数据和测试数据上的表现都不佳。

为了解决过拟合问题,可以采用正则化、dropout等技术手段来减少模型的复杂度;为了解决欠拟合问题,可以增加模型的复杂度、增加训练数据等方法来提高模型的性能。

2.3 模型评估与部署

2.3.1 模型评估指标与评估方法

在Langchain大模型的评估过程中,需要选择合适的评估指标和评估方法。常见的评估指标包括准确率、召回率、F1值等,这些指标可以衡量模型在不同任务上的性能表现。

langchain大模型开发常见问题(FAQs)

1、什么是langchain大模型开发?

Langchain大模型开发是指利用大量文本数据训练出的大型自然语言处理模型,旨在提高机器理解和生成人类语言的能力。这种模型可以应用于多种任务,如问答、文本生成、语义理解等。

2、Langchain大模型开发需要哪些技术和工具?

Langchain大模型开发需要深度学习框架(如TensorFlow、PyTorch)、大规模语料库、高性能计算资源以及自然语言处理(NLP)技术,如词嵌入、循环神经网络(RNN)、变换器(Transformer)等。此外,还需要使用到一些辅助工具,如数据预处理工具、模型训练工具、模型评估工具等。

3、Langchain大模型开发过程中会遇到哪些常见问题?

在Langchain大模型开发过程中,可能会遇到数据质量不高、模型过拟合、计算资源不足、训练时间长等问题。为了解决这些问题,需要采取一系列措施,如数据清洗、正则化、模型剪枝、分布式训练等。

4、如何解决Langchain大模型开发中的常见问题?

针对Langchain大模型开发中的常见问题,可以采取以下措施:1)数据清洗:对原始数据进行预处理,去除低质量、不相关的数据,提高数据质量;2)正则化:通过添加正则化项来防止模型过拟合;3)模型剪枝:通过减少模型参数数量来降低模型复杂度,减少过拟合风险;4)分布式训练:利用多台机器并行训练模型,提高训练速度和效率。

发表评论

评论列表

暂时没有评论,有什么想聊的?

物联网IOT系统定制

物联网IOT系统定制

连接万物,智慧生活。定制物联网IOT系统,助您实现设备互联,引领物联网时代。

热推产品-园区经济监测

区域经济运行与监测平台

企业分析发展监测,具备企业图谱、图像分析、指标健康和全要素数据库四大功能



langchain大模型开发:解决常见问题的实用技巧最新资讯

分享关于大数据最新动态,数据分析模板分享,如何使用低代码构建大数据管理平台和低代码平台开发软件

电气火灾远程监控系统:你的安全守护者,你还在等什么?

一、电气火灾远程监控系统的概述 电气火灾远程监控系统的定义 远程监控系统是一种利用现代信息技术,实现对电气火灾隐患的实时监测和预警的系统。它通过各种传感器和通信技

...
2024-04-20 21:36:57
安消联动系统如何实现真正的安全和消防一体化?

安消联动系统如何实现真正的安全和消防一体化? 一、概述 * 安消联动系统定义:安消联动系统是将安全(Security)与消防(Fire)两个系统有机结合,实现安全与消防的无缝衔

...
2024-04-20 21:36:24
低压配电柜智能仪表监控系统如何提高配电效率?

**一、低压配电柜智能仪表监控系统的概述** 1. ** 什么是低压配电柜智能仪表监控系统? ** 低压配电柜智能仪表监控系统是一种利用现代信息技术和通信技术对低压配电柜进行

...
2024-04-20 21:37:10

langchain大模型开发:解决常见问题的实用技巧相关资讯

与langchain大模型开发:解决常见问题的实用技巧相关资讯,您可以对物联网IOT系统定制了解更多

速优云

让监测“简单一点”

×

欢迎访问速优云官网!

咨询电话:17190186096

扫码加顾问微信 -->

速优云PerfCloud官方微信